2017 Conference – Thursday Nov 16th 09.45-13.00

Information informs, guides, and empowers; but barriers to access and use can be societally divisive, particularly amongst marginalised and disadvantaged groups.

For the past 2.5 years the University of Strathclyde, funded by the Economic and Social Research Council, has been working in the field with young first time mothers and their support workers, to better understand their information needs and seeking preferences, the barriers and challenges experienced, and how  young mothers are best supported to prosper in the digital age.

This event presents and discusses the key findings from this research as part of the release of our public report, Getting it right first time: supporting the Information needs of young mothers.
